Button Down Purchases Filly at OBS

Button Down Racing purchased a 2-Y-O daughter of Forest Camp at the OBSC auction on April 21 in Ocala, Florida. Bloodstock agent Tim Kegel signed the ticket for BDR, five days after the filly recorded a sizzling eighth-mile move in :09-4/5 in the under-tack show. The dark bay filly is out of No Little Angel, a Lord Carson mare, and is Kentucky-bred.

“Tim really liked the way she was put together and the way she acted in the ring,” said Button Down Racing’s president, Michael Hardesty. “I wasn’t sure we could get her considering the sub-10-second work. That might not translate into a quality racehorse but she has a shot, and I at least know on the morning of her under-tack breeze, she surely had some turn-of-foot. It’ll be fun to see what we can do with her.”
